基于jQuery的图片加载loading效果插件
2013-12-16 13:58
711 查看
基于jQuery的图片加载loading效果插件
图片loading的效果是网页中比较常见的,尤其是对大图片,loading效果让用户能够明白图片加载的过程。
实现思路也是比较简单的:
在此基础上还可以使用到其他比如轮播图片、延迟加载上。
查看DEMO
FROM: http://www.rockydo.com/articleDetail.php?id=52
图片loading的效果是网页中比较常见的,尤其是对大图片,loading效果让用户能够明白图片加载的过程。
实现思路也是比较简单的:
$.fn.LoadingImg = function() { return this.each(function() { var that = this; var src = $(this).attr("src2"); //获取当前的src2属性 var img = new Image(); //建立新图片 img.src = src; var loading = $("<img alt=\"加载中...\" class=\"loadingImg\" title=\"图片加载中...\" src=\"loading.gif\" />"); $(this).after(loading); //添加loading图片 $(this).hide(); //隐藏当前图片 $(img).load(function() { //当前图片下载完毕后 loading.remove(); $(that).attr("src", src); $(that).show(); }); }); };
在此基础上还可以使用到其他比如轮播图片、延迟加载上。
查看DEMO
FROM: http://www.rockydo.com/articleDetail.php?id=52
相关文章推荐
- 关于Jquery中ajax方法data参数用法的总结
- jquery text()
- 使用jquery构建Metro style 返回顶部
- 实现分页pagration的方法jquery(个人感觉用到了easyui貌似)
- Reveal Jquery 模式对话框插件
- jquery图片上下翻滚、图片左右翻滚、图片淡隐淡现3种图片滚动特效
- jQuery.Autocomplete实现自动完成功能(详解)
- jQuery文件下载插件 Downloadr
- jQuery:hasClass() 方法检查被选元素是否包含指定的 class;after()在某元素之后插入新元素
- 强烈推荐:240多个jQuery插件
- jQuery Mobile 入门基础教程
- 使用java的html解析器jsoup和jQuery实现一个自动重复抓取任意网站页面指定元素的web应用
- 带有查询和排序功能的jquery分页插件——DataTables
- 使用jQuery的9个误区
- Signs of a poorly written jQuery plugin 翻译 (Jquery插件开发注意事项,Jquey官方推荐)
- JQuery 限制文本框只能输入数字和小数点
- Jquery类级别与对象级别插件开发
- 快速开发 jQuery 插件的 10 大技巧(转)
- jquery中当text文本框为空时,button按钮是disabled状态,否则为enable状态
- jquery中当text文本框为空时,button按钮是disabled状态,否则为enable状态且输入框只能输入数字。并用alert显示第一个数字